These 3 pepper plants have been growing since late may when i transplanted them from a six pack. They have produced about 15 lbs so far and are still setting peppers. The leaves have started yellowing and falling off, the tips of the leaves are also getting black/brown. The is happening on all 3 plants. The plants were fertilized in mid June with bone meal and epsom salts. They are in containers. I've been watering every two to three days. What is this?

My first thought would be a Nitrogen deficiency. I would recommend using a complete fertilizer especially since they are in containers. Hopefully somebody else will post more info soon.
